هذا هو الأمر amk_grf الذي يمكن تشغيله في مزود الاستضافة المجانية OnWorks باستخدام إحدى محطات العمل المجانية المتعددة على الإنترنت مثل Ubuntu Online أو Fedora Online أو محاكي Windows عبر الإنترنت أو محاكي MAC OS عبر الإنترنت
برنامج:
اسم
amk_grf - إنشاء بنية مستهدفة من الرسم البياني المصدر
موجز
amk_grf [الخيارات] [com.gfile] [com.tfile]
الوصف
إنّ الـ amk_grf يقوم البرنامج ببناء بنية هدف محددة التحلل com.tfile من المصدر
رسم بياني com.gfile.
تحدد البنى الهدف طوبولوجيا الرسوم البيانية المستهدفة التي يستخدمها التعيين الثابت
برامج com.gmap(1) و com.dgmap(1). يمكن أن تكون البنى الهدف إما معرّفة خوارزميًا ،
للطبولوجيا المشتركة أو العادية أو المحددة بالتحلل ، مثل تلك التي تنتجها
amk_grf.
عندما يتم تضمين المكتبات المناسبة في وقت الترجمة ، amk_grf يمكن التعامل معها مباشرة
الملفات المضغوطة ، كمدخلات ومخرجات. يتم التعامل مع التدفق على أنه مضغوط عندما يكون
name هو postfixed بامتداد ملف مضغوط ، مثل "brol.tgt.bz2" أو "-.gz".
تنسيقات الضغط التي يمكن دعمها هي تنسيق bzip2 (".bz2") ، تنسيق gzip
تنسيق (".gz") ، وتنسيق lzma (".lzma" ، عند الإدخال فقط).
نظرًا لأن ملفات بنية الهدف المعرفة بالتحلل لها حجم تربيعي في
عدد الرؤوس المستهدفة ، بسبب وجود بنية مصفوفة المسافة ،
قد يؤدي استخدام الملفات المضغوطة لتخزينها إلى توفير مساحة كبيرة.
OPTIONS
-bSTRAT
تطبيق استراتيجية ثنائية التقسيم STRAT لحساب التقسيم العودي الثنائي لـ
الرسم البياني المصدر بأكمله إلى نطاقات فرعية مستهدفة أصغر.
-h اعرض بعض المساعدة.
-lملف
احتفظ فقط بالرؤوس التي تنتمي مؤشراتها إلى قائمة مفصولة بمسافات مخزنة
in ملف. يسمح هذا للمرء بإنشاء بنى مستهدفة يمكن حتى فصلها
مجموعات فرعية من بنية مستهدفة أكبر ، على غرار الرسم البياني.
-V عرض نسخة البرنامج وحقوق التأليف والنشر.
مثال
قم بإنشاء بنية مستهدفة معرّفة بالتحلل من رسم بياني لمصدر شبكة عادي ثنائي الأبعاد
البعد 3 مرات 5 ، وحفظه ، كعمارة مستهدفة مجمعة ، تحت GZIP(1)
بتنسيق ، إلى ملف "m3x5.tgt.gz".
$ gmk_m2 3 5 | amk_grf | acpl - m3x5.tgt.gz
لاحظ أنه في هذه الحالة بالتحديد ، سيكون من الأفضل كثيرًا استخدام "mesh2D" مباشرةً
بنية الهدف المحددة حسابيًا.
$ echo "mesh2D 3 5"> m3x5.tgt
استخدم amk_grf عبر الإنترنت باستخدام خدمات onworks.net